随着社会的进步和科技的发展,电子画册已经成为商业宣传和个人展示的重要手段。而其中最常见的翻页效果也成为了电子画册制作中不可或缺的一部分。本文将介绍如何利用HTML、CSS、JavaScript等技术制作一个具有翻页效果的电子画册。
在开始制作之前,我们需要准备以下材料:
第一步:基本HTML结构搭建
首先,我们需要在HTML文件中编写基本框架。
第二步:CSS样式设置
接下来,我们需要设置CSS样式。
* {margin: 0;
padding: 0;
}
body {
font-family: Arial, sans-serif;
}
.container {
width: 100vw;
height: 100vh;
}
.page {
position: absolute;
}第三步:JS代码编写
然后,我们需要编写JS代码。
// 定义全局变量var currentPage = -1; // 当前页码
var totalPages = $('.page').length -1 ; // 总页数
// 翻页函数
function flipPage() {
if (currentPage >= totalPages) return false;
currentPage++;
$('.page').eq(currentPage).addClass('active');
}
// 监听键盘事件
$(document).keydown(function (e) {
if (e.keyCode == '37') { //左箭头
console.log('上一页');
} else if (e.keyCode == '39') { //右箭头
console.log('下一页');
flipPage();
}
});至此,一个简单的翻页效果的电子画册就完成了。当然,这只是一个最简单版本的实现方法,在实际应用中还有很多细节需要注意。比如对响应式设计的支持、页面加载速度优化、动态添加或删除页面等功能。
通过学习这篇文章,相信读者们已经掌握了如何制作翻页效果的电子画册,并且能够进一步扩展其功能。希望大家能够将所学知识运用到实际项目中去,并取得良好的成果!
网站名称:如何制作翻页的电子画册(如何制作翻页的电子画册教程)
链接URL:https://www.syh-b.com/qtweb/news35/599185.html
圣合创意、聚焦快消品商业设计品牌整合设计14年;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 圣合创意